Tungkol sa kursong ito

Double Affine Hecke Algebras (DAHA), also known as Cherednik algebras, lie at the intersection of modern algebra, geometry, and mathematical physics, yet finding a clear entry point can be challenging. This text-based course demystifies these advanced algebraic structures by building your knowledge from the ground up, starting with essential prerequisites in Lie theory and root systems. By reading our structured explanations and working through algebraic examples, you will develop a deep conceptual intuition for how these algebras unify diverse mathematical fields. What you'll learn: 1. Understand the foundational definitions of root systems, Weyl groups, and classical Hecke algebras. 2. Explore the construction of affine and double affine Hecke algebras from basic principles. 3. Analyze the representations of Cherednik algebras and their key algebraic properties. 4. Discover the connections between DAHA, integrable systems, and Macdonald orthogonal polynomials. 5. Apply these algebraic tools to concepts in quantum groups and mathematical physics. 6. Identify current research trends and open problems in modern representation theory. We begin with a gentle introduction to the necessary background in abstract algebra and Lie theory, ensuring you have the prerequisites to succeed. From there, the text guides you through the step-by-step construction of double affine structures, concluding with their remarkable applications in geometry and physics. This course is ideal for advanced undergraduates, early-stage graduate students, and mathematical enthusiasts looking for a clear, self-paced introduction to this profound subject.
